Encountering the Revered Black Madonna

Guided Visit to the Enchanting Montserrat Monastery - Encountering the Revered Black Madonna

Visitors to the Montserrat Monastery are drawn to the Basilica’s most prized possession – the revered Black Madonna, or "La Moreneta."

This 12th-century wooden statue, crafted in the Romanesque style, is believed to hold profound religious and cultural significance for the Catalan people.

The Black Madonna:

  1. Sits enthroned in a small, dimly lit chapel, her serene expression captivating worshippers.

  2. Adorned with precious jewels and garments, reflecting her esteemed status as the patron saint of Catalonia.

  3. Draws pilgrims from around the world to pray, touch, and revere this sacred icon.

Tour Inclusions and Important Considerations

Guided Visit to the Enchanting Montserrat Monastery - Tour Inclusions and Important Considerations

The Montserrat Monastery guided visit includes transport by air-conditioned bus, an expert guide, access to the Basilica, and a tasting of 4 local liqueurs for those 21 and older.

Plus, the tour provides entrance to an audiovisual exhibition in Montserrat. Hotel pick-up and drop-off service is available.

It’s a shared tour format, so booking multiple tours close in time isn’t advisable. Guests are encouraged to provide a WhatsApp number for post-booking support.

Last-minute bookings may be rescheduled if the tour is full. The tour isn’t suitable for wheelchair users.

Is There a Dress Code for the Monastery Visit?

The tour operator advises visitors to wear modest clothing that covers shoulders and knees when visiting the Montserrat Monastery. This is respectful of the religious nature of the site. Casual, comfortable attire is appropriate.

Are Photography and Videography Allowed Inside the Monastery?

Photography and videography are generally allowed inside the Montserrat Monastery, but visitors should be respectful and avoid disrupting services or other activities. Some areas may have restrictions, so it’s best to follow the guide’s instructions during the tour.
